The correlation between historical prices or returns on Mfs Diversified Income and Franklin Income is a relative statistical measure of the degree to which these equity instruments tend to move together. The correlation coefficient measures the extent to which returns on Franklin Income Fund are associated (or correlated) with Mfs Diversified. Values of the correlation coefficient range from -1 to +1, where. The correlation of zero (0) is possible when the price movement of Mfs Diversified Income has no effect on the direction of Franklin Income i.e., Franklin Income and Mfs Diversified go up and down completely randomly.

Pair Trading with Franklin Income and Mfs Diversified

The main advantage of trading using opposite Franklin Income and Mfs Diversified posit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Franklin Income position performs unexpectedly, Mfs Diversified can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in Mfs Diversified will offset losses from the drop in Mfs Diversified's long position.
The idea behind Franklin Income Fund and Mfs Diversified Income pairs trading is to make the combined position market-neutral, meaning the overall market's direction will not affect its win or loss (or potential downside or upside). This can be achieved by designing a pairs trade with two highly correlated stocks or equities that operate in a similar space or sector, making it possible to obtain profits through simple and relatively low-risk investment.
